Simplify Your Life ~ Focus on doing, not on spending

Without realizing it we send messages to our kids about how to live life, base on what we do.  We shop, eat out, go to the zoo, go to the movies, so our kids learns that having fun means spending money.  We tend to focus on material things, so therefore they do too.  Instead, try teaching them that doing stuff together is more important then buying stuff.  Don't just tell them, also show them by your actions.  Go for walks in the park, play at a local playground (visit a new one every week, kids LOVE this), play outdoors, play board games or card games, read together, do chores together, go to the beach or wash the car together.  Spend quality time together, doing stuff that doesn't cost money.
